What is the function of a Gated Way in fire hose operation?

The function of a Gated Way in fire hose operation is primarily to enable the use of multiple hoses from one water source. This device allows firefighters to connect several hoses to a single supply line, which is particularly advantageous during firefighting efforts that require multiple streams of water for effective suppression. By using a Gated Way, firefighters can maximize the water flow efficiency by distributing it across several hoses simultaneously, effectively enhancing their operational capabilities in combating fire.

While other devices and components in fire hose systems serve functions such as providing shut-off points, preventing leaks, or adjusting flow rates, the unique role of a Gated Way is its ability to create multiple outputs from a single input, allowing for a coordinated and efficient firefighting strategy. This aspect is crucial in scenarios where different areas need coverage or when more than one team is deployed.
